Récupérer des missions

Récupérer toutes les missions de vos partenaires avec des filtres précis.

Rechercher des missions

get
/v0/mission

Retourne les missions diffusées par vos partenaires, filtrées selon vos critères. Les résultats sont limités aux partenaires autorisés pour votre clé API.

Les paramètres "activity", "city", "clientId", "country", "departmentName", "domain", "organizationRNA", "organizationStatusJuridique", "publisher", "remote" et "type" acceptent une valeur unique ou un tableau de valeurs (ex. "?domain=sante&domain=education").

Authorizations
x-api-keystringRequired

Clé API fournie par l'équipe API Engagement

Query parameters
limitinteger · max: 10000Optional

Nombre de résultats (défaut 25, max 10 000)

Default: 25
skipintegerOptional

Décalage pour la pagination

Default: 0
keywordsstringOptional

Recherche textuelle (titre, description, organisation)

Example: cuisine solidaire
domainone ofOptional

Domaine d'action

Example: sante
stringOptional
or
string[]Optional
activityone ofOptional

Activité proposée

stringOptional
or
string[]Optional
typeone ofOptional

Type d'engagement : benevolat, volontariat_service_civique, volontariat_sapeurs_pompiers

stringOptional
or
string[]Optional
remoteone ofOptional

Modalité de télétravail : no, possible, full

stringOptional
or
string[]Optional
latnumber · doubleOptional

Latitude (requis avec "lon" pour la recherche géographique)

Example: 48.8566
lonnumber · doubleOptional

Longitude (requis avec "lat" pour la recherche géographique)

Example: 2.3522
distancestringOptional

Rayon de recherche géographique (ex. 25km, 50km). Défaut : 50km

Example: 25km
cityone ofOptional

Filtre par ville

stringOptional
or
string[]Optional
departmentNameone ofOptional

Filtre par département

Example: Rhône
stringOptional
or
string[]Optional
countryone ofOptional

Filtre par pays

stringOptional
or
string[]Optional
clientIdone ofOptional

Filtre par identifiant client

stringOptional
or
string[]Optional
publisherone ofOptional

Filtre sur les identifiants de partenaires diffuseurs

stringOptional
or
string[]Optional
organizationRNAone ofOptional

Filtre par numéro RNA de l'organisation

stringOptional
or
string[]Optional
organizationStatusJuridiqueone ofOptional

Filtre par forme juridique de l'organisation

stringOptional
or
string[]Optional
openToMinorsstring · enumOptional

Missions ouvertes aux mineurs uniquement

Possible values:
reducedMobilityAccessiblestring · enumOptional

Missions accessibles PMR uniquement

Possible values:
snustring · enumOptional

Missions Service National Universel uniquement

Possible values:
startAtstringOptional

Filtre sur la date de début (ex. >2024-01-01, <2024-12-31)

createdAtstringOptional

Filtre sur la date de création (ex. >2024-01-01)

Responses
chevron-right
200

Liste de missions

application/json
okbooleanOptionalExample: true
totalintegerOptional

Nombre total de résultats correspondants

Example: 1234
limitintegerOptionalExample: 25
skipintegerOptionalExample: 0
get
/v0/mission

Last updated